How long will your business be listed for?
There is no clearly defined timeline to getting offers. We have seen businesses close within weeks. We have also seen other businesses that take close to a year.
This depends on what type of offers you are willing to accept, how large your business is and what industry & monetization process your business utilizes.
Upward Exits takes care of the majority of the disposition process.
We ask for full disclosure of business history, financials, and expectations.
During the valuation process we will likely need 5-10 hours of your time.
Once buyers begin to make offers, 5-10 hours is typically needed from the seller for phone calls and to provide live verifications to buyers. It typically takes 3-4 calls in order to get a serious offer on the business.
The business closing and migration process typically takes 10-20 hours from each party.
